Compared to other kinds, hydraulic lifts are basic to run. This kind of scissor lift is quieter and doesn't discharge exhaust fumes. This makes it suitable for indoor work sites. Electrics tend to be smaller sized, that makes them well suited for little, confined rooms. Required some charging suggestions for your electric scissor lift? Have a look at this post!.?. !! Diesel scissor lifts are loud, and they send out exhaust fumes.




They are commonly discovered on construction websites and various other tasks that require lifting heavy tools and devices. These scissor lifts make use of air stress to increase and decrease the platform. They're not as powerful as other scissor lifts, yet do not send out fumes. They can be utilized in a lot of work environments, consisting of inside your home.

Check every scissor lift before each change. Make sure all employees that examine the lifts are trained on what problems to look for and exactly how to remedy them.


OSHAs guidelines for this procedure include: Inspect all liquid levels. This consists of oil, gas, coolant, and hydraulics. Keep an eye out for any leaks. Examine the wheels and tires. Try to find worn tire treads and cracks or bubbles in the sidewalls. Make sure tire stress goes to the correct PSI.


The Best Strategy To Use For Lift Maintenance


Check the steering and brakes to guarantee they are fully functional. Test all emergency situation controls to make sure they are functioning. Make sure all personal protection tools are in place and are functioning effectively.


Maintain a written record every time scissor lift upkeep is carried out. This record is required in instance of a scissor lift accident. If you can't show correct upkeep to OSHA, it can result in raised fines and further legal action.
